

Philadelphia’s health organizations unite to take down high blood pressure
Philadelphia College of Osteopathic Medicine and Jefferson Health join Penn Medicine, Temple Health and the American Heart Association to expand lifesaving hypertension care and education across the city. – Read more: Philadelphia’s health organizations unite to take down high blood pressure – Eastern States Blog
